Direct Inoculation is a process where the examination sample is straight inoculated into the exact two varieties of media talked about higher than, As a result bypassing the filtration phase. This take a look at is normally reserved for test samples that display incompatibility Together with the Membrane Filtration method.
The sample ought to be under 10% in the media’s overall quantity. The direct inoculation method is useful for products that aren't filterable or deformable, for instance surgical sutures, gauze, and dressings. What's more, it consumes a lot less item volume than other methods. Membrane Filtration

Commonly, sterility testing is really a regulatory requirement for the release of Organic and pharmaceutical products that cannot be terminally sterilized (i.e. products that are warmth-labile and therefore susceptible to destruction by heat); and sterility exam still continue being a pass for the release website of Organic products for public use. Considering that sterility testing can not on its own certify absolutely the assurance of independence of an item from microbial contamination, it is significant that each manufacturing procedures (Particularly People designed for the production of Organic products) ensures a continued and rigorous compliance to Good Manufacturing Procedures (GMPs) at each output stage.
